We are currently seeking a Regulatory Affairs Coordinator who is passionate about cosmetic regulatory compliance. We are looking for a candidate who has familiarity with PIFs, CPSRs, labelling requirements, and regulatory submissions. This role will primarily focus on regulatory document compilation & existing product changes.

The regulatory team sits within the legal department and is focused on both regulatory compliance and consumer safety to meet the higher standards of quality and commerciality. The role will work closely with the Brand, NPD, Manufacturing, Laboratory and commercial teams to provide expert technical knowledge to support both new formulation and maintenance of our existing portfolio.

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and maintain Product Information Files (PIFs)
  • Assist product notifications across EMEA, EU, UK, APAC and US markets via relevant portals (CPNP, FDA, etc.)
  • Support reformulation projects thought regulatory assessment and documentation
  • Review labelling compliance across markets
  • Assist on implementing regulatory changes and updates across all existing markets
  • Monitor regulatory developments and updates in key markets
  • Maintain regulatory databases and filing systems
  • Strong knowledge of the EU Cosmetic regulation (EC 1223/2009) with understanding of UK, US and other market regulations
  • Bachelor’s degree in Cosmetic Science, Pharmaceutical Sciences, Chemistry, Toxicology, or related field.
  • Excellent organisational skill and attention to detail
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to work independently and with clients.
  • Previous internship or work experience in cosmetics and personal care
  • Knowledge of INCI nomenclature and cosmetics ingredients
